Hallo Jörn, > > Mit dem Befehl "FilterName ("A*'")" filtere ich alle Datensätze, > deren Feld "Name" mit dem Buchstaben "A" beginnt. > > Das funktioniert einwandfrei > (und für jeden Buchstaben habe ich mir ein Makro erstellt). > > Wenn das geschehen ist, kann ich mich allerdings > mit den Navigationssymbolen nicht durch die > gefilterten Datensätze bewegen. > Das geht erst, wenn ich vorher in ein beliebiges Feld klicke.
Hast Du ein Formular erstellt? Vielleicht hast Du ja etwas mit Unterformularen gestaltet, so dass den Navigationssymbolen unklar ist, auf welches Formular sie sich beziehen können. Ich würde in das entsprechende Unterformular eine Navigationsleiste einbauen statt ein Makro zu erstellen, das einen Sprung ins Unterformular verursacht. > > Daher suche ich eine Makro-Ergänzung, > die dieses Anklicken eines Feldes bewirkt. Müsste doch eigentlich mit dem Makrorecorder erfolgen, oder? Ansonsten muss ich noch einmal schauen, was ich vor eingier Zeit bei einer Beispieldatenbank dazu konstruiert habe: Beipiel für eine Listbox im Formular mit dem Namen "Medien": rem Formular ansteuern, Listbox ansteuern, Listbox neu einlesen odoc=thisComponent odrawpage=odoc.drawpage oform=odrawpage.forms.getByName("Medien") oControl=oform.getByName(NameListBox) oControl.refresh() Vielleicht ein Ansatz. Gruß Robert --------------------------------------------------------------------- To unsubscribe, e-mail: users-unsubscr...@de.openoffice.org For additional commands, e-mail: users-h...@de.openoffice.org